Understanding VPN Basics
At its core, a VPN is designed to encrypt your internet connection and mask your online identity. Picture it as a tunnelâyour data enters it from one end, gets protected through encryption, and exits securely at the other end. This process keeps prying eyesâbe it hackers or government entitiesâfrom snooping into your online habits.
There are a few key components to grasp in this:
- Encryption: This is the backbone of any good VPN. It scrambles your data, making it unreadable to anyone who tries to intercept it.
- IP Address Masking: Your device's IP address can reveal a lot about you, from your physical location to your internet service provider. A VPN hides your true IP, showing instead the address of the VPN server you are connected to.
- Protocols: Different VPNs use various protocols, like OpenVPN or L2TP, which dictate how data is transmitted. These protocols determine the VPNâs speed and security level.
With these basics in mind, it's clear that VPNs play a crucial role in maintaining your online privacy as they provide an extra layer of security. As users become more aware of data breaches and surveillance, knowing how a VPN operates can significantly influence their online choices.

History and Development
Hotspot Shield has a rich history that traces back over a decade. Launched in 2008 by Pango Inc., the service set out with a mission to protect user privacy and deliver uninterrupted online experiences.
Initially, it garnered attention as a simple tool to bypass geographic restrictions; however, it quickly evolved to address the growing concerns around security and data privacy. Over the years, developers have introduced several updates that refined its functionality, enhancing speed and stability significantly. By integrating advanced encryption protocols and user-friendly interfaces, Hotspot Shield has cemented its reputation as a trusted ally in the digital age.

Performance and Speed
Performance is the make-or-break factor for most VPNs. Hotspot Shield claims to offer some of the fastest speedsâupwards of 25 Mbps under optimal conditions. This level of performance is vital for tasks like streaming high-definition content or engaging in data-heavy activities without a hitch.
Users may notice the difference in speed compared to other VPN services. However, itâs important to note that network performance can fluctuate depending on several factors:
- Server Load: Heavily trafficked servers can slow your connection.
- Geographic Location: Depending on where you are connecting from, latency may differ.
- Internet Connection: Your base internet speed before engaging the VPN also plays a role.
A consistent connection with minimal lag aligns well with the needs of both casual users and professionals relying on robust digital environments.
Privacy and Security Features
The need for privacy and security while browsing is paramount, and here, Hotspot Shield pulls no punches. It utilizes military-grade encryption standards, making it significantly challenging for unauthorized parties to intercept your data.
Hereâs what you should know about its privacy features:
- No-Log Policy: Hotspot Shield maintains a no-log policy, meaning they do not record user activities, ensuring anonymity.
- Malware Protection: The software incorporates malware blockers, offering an additional layer of defense against harmful content.
- WebRTC Leak Protection: This ensures that IP addresses do not unintentionally leak during browsing.
Ultimately, these features act as a safety net in the unpredictable landscape of the internet.

System Requirements
Before you embark on the installation journey, it's wise to first check the system requirements. Having the right setup can make or break your experience with the VPN. Here are the essentials:


- A computer running Windows, macOS, or Linux
- The latest version of Chrome browser
- At least 256 MB of RAM and 50 MB of available disk space
- An internet connection for downloading the extension
Having these specifications in place ensures smooth installation and optimal performance once the VPN is active. Step-by-Step Installation Guide
Installing Hotspot Shield on Chrome is as easy as pie if you follow these steps carefully:
- Open Chrome Browser: Start by launching your Chrome browser, ensuring itâs the latest version.
- Visit the Chrome Web Store: Navigate to the Chrome Web Store where you can search for various extensions.
- Search for Hotspot Shield: Type "Hotspot Shield VPN" in the search bar, and hit enter.
- Select the Right Extension: Look for the official extension by Pango Inc. (Hotspot Shield VPN), and click on it. Be vigilant about choosing the legitimate one to avoid knockoffs.
- Click on Add to Chrome: Once you land on the extension page, youâll see an "Add to Chrome" button in the top right corner. Click it.
- Confirm Installation: A pop-up window will appear asking you to confirm. Click "Add Extension" to move forward.
- Wait for Installation: The extension will download and install; give it a moment. A notification will pop up letting you know it was successfully added.
- Pin the Extension: To keep it handy, you can pin Hotspot Shield to your browser's toolbar. Just click on the puzzle piece icon in the toolbar and select the pin next to Hotspot Shield.
- Set Up Your Account: Open the extension, and you'll need to log in or create an account to access VIP features. Follow the prompts here.
By adhering to this step-by-step guide, youâll manage to install Hotspot Shield on Chrome like a pro. Installation, while straightforward, sets the stage for a more secure online experience. Common Issues Faced
While the benefits might outweigh the drawbacks for many, there are common challenges that users face with Hotspot Shield. Understanding these issues can help current and prospective users better prepare for their VPN experience. Hereâs a closer look at some recurring problems:
- Connection Drops: A few users notice unexpected disconnections. This can be frustrating, particularly during important online activities like streaming or video conferencing.
- Limited Access in Certain Regions: Although Hotspot Shield is designed to bypass geo-blocks, some users report difficulties accessing content from specific countries due to detection by certain services.
- Subscription Tiers: While the free version has its appeals, many voices complain about limitations on data usage and server options, which could lead to frustration for those who need more robust features yet feel hesitant to pay.
These common issues can influence a userâs overall experience, and addressing them head-on can contribute to making informed decisions on whether or not to adopt Hotspot Shield.

Optimizing Settings for Browsing
To make the most of Hotspot Shield, fine-tuning its settings is vital. Hereâs how you can optimize the service for browsing:
- Automatic Start-Up: Configure Hotspot Shield to start automatically with your browser. This prevents any unprotected browsing sessions when you open Chrome.
- Select Optimal Server Locations: Choose servers that are geographically closer to you for better speed. Hotspot Shield offers various locations, so ensure you pick one that balances performance and privacy needs.
- Protocol Selection: Experiment with different VPN protocols provided by Hotspot Shield. For instance, if you prioritize speed, the Catapult Hydra protocol may be best, but for stronger security, consider OpenVPN.
- Check Your IP Leak Protection: Make sure the option for DNS leak protection is enabled. This feature keeps your browsing data private by preventing your ISP from catching a whiff of your activities.
- Disable WebRTC: Sometimes, browsers can leak your real IP address through WebRTC, especially on Chrome. It's prudent to disable this feature as part of your privacy strategy.
Making these tweaks will not only enhance your browsing speed but will also ensure that your sensitive data remains concealed from prying eyes.
